Is 587748013 a prime number?
It is possible to find out using mathematical methods whether a given integer is a prime number or not.
No, 587 748 013 is not a prime number.
For example, 587 748 013 can be divided by 14 401: 587 748 013 / 14401 = 40 813.
For 587 748 013 to be a prime number, it would have been required that 587 748 013 has only two divisors, i.e., itself and 1.
